Karyna Bajaj

Foodpreneur

Karyna Bajaj, Executive Director at KA Hospitality, centres around the monetary and business methodology, as well as, rebuilding and business making arrangements for the Group. Karyna joined the business in July 2016 and has been instrumental in growing the public impression of the Hakkasan and Yauatcha brands in India.

Karyna is one of a handful of women in the hospitality business in India today.

Dipna Anand

Dipna Anand is an honour-winning celebrity chef and proprietor of Dip in Brilliant. She likewise co-claims Brilliant Restaurant in Southall, London. Her granddad began the main Brilliant café in Nairobi, Kenya during the 1950s.

She additionally runs her own Cookery School, The Brilliant Restaurant in Indian Foods.

Jyoti Ganapathi, Founder

Jyoti Ganapathi likewise comes from a non-F&B foundation, however, her adoration for South Indian cooking moved her to open Dosa Inc., a food truck brand that serves the conventional South Indian supper. Dosa Inc. is well known for genuine South Indian cooking and keeps on getting ready dishes utilising age-old family plans.

Dipti Motiani

Dipti Motiani is the originator of Second Nature, a brand that is arising as a harbinger in the cool extricated products of the soil juice mixes class. She is additionally the Vice President of the  Processed Fruits division at Freshtrop Fruits Ltd., which is the parent organisation of Second Nature. The fresh top has been the main provider of new Indian grapes to probably the most requesting Supermarkets in Europe.

Pallavi Jayswal is a culinary wizard – gourmet specialist, foodie and finance manager. She is the gourmet expert and prime supporter at Uno Más – Tapas Bar Kitchen. She had additionally helped to establish an organization Nessun Dorma Food Ventures. Her first authority culinary occupation was at the world-renowned hub of Indian fine eat, Indigo Restaurant at Colaba. She was tasked with handling a whole segment of the kitchen.
